What Constitutes an Emergency Rat Situation

An emergency rat situation typically involves a visibly large infestation, evidence of rats in critical areas like kitchens or bedrooms, or the rapid spread of signs indicating a growing problem. Homeowners and business owners in Logan Square, with its estimated population of 73,702, understand the importance of maintaining a safe and healthy environment. When rats are actively causing damage, such as chewing through electrical wires—a common concern in older Chicago housing stock—or contaminating food storage areas, immediate professional assistance is critical to prevent fires or widespread disease transmission.

Typical Service Execution

  • Initial Assessment: Professionals will first con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the extent of the infestation, locate entry points, nesting sites, and determine the species of rat involved.
  • Targeted Treatment: Based on their findings, they will implement immediate control measures. This often involves the strategic placement of tamper-resistant bait stations in areas frequented by rats.
  • Hardware Installation: For more persistent or severe infestations, exclusion methods might be employed. This could include sealing entry points with durable materials like steel wool, caulk, or hardware cloth to prevent future access.
  • Sanitation Recommendations: Experts will also advise on sanitation practices to make your property less attractive to rodents in the future, such as securing trash bins and cleaning up food sources.
  • Follow-Up: Depending on the severity, follow-up visits may be scheduled to ensure the infestation is fully resolved and to monitor for any signs of recurrence.

Commonly Used Methods and Materials

Local exterminators often rely on scientifically-backed methods for effective rodent control. This can include:

  • Rodenticides: Carefully selected and strategically placed baits that are highly effective when used responsibly by trained professionals.
  • Trapping: Various types of traps, from snap traps to live traps, are used depending on the situation and client preference.
  • Exclusion Materials: Heavy-duty sealants, wire mesh, and other durable materials are used to permanently block entry points.

What rats destroy in Logan Square homes

Once inside, rats cause real, costly damage in the Logan Square area homes: they gnaw constantly to wear down their teeth, and chewed electrical wiring is a leading, under-recognized cause of house fires. They shred insulation and stored belongings for nesting, gnaw through drywall, pipes, and even softer structural wood, and foul attics, wall voids, and pantries with urine and droppings that soak into insulation and subfloor. A small entry today becomes a costly repair later — which is why removal and permanent exclusion beat one-off trapping.

Logan Square rodent warning signs

The clearest signs of rats in the Logan Square area homes: fresh droppings along baseboards and near food, gnaw marks on wood, wiring, and packaging, dark grease rub-marks where they travel walls, scratching or scurrying inside walls and ceilings at night, shredded-paper or insulation nests, and a lingering musky ammonia smell. The sounds and smell usually appear before you ever see one.

How Emergency Rat Control works in Logan Square

A proper Emergency Rat Control job in Logan Square works in a set order: a full inspection to map entry points and nesting sites, exclusion first — sealing every gap wider than a quarter inch around pipes, vents, and the foundation — then trapping and removal of the active population, followed by clean-out and disinfection of nesting material and droppings to erase the scent trails that draw new rodents back. For an active, urgent infestation, same-day response limits the contamination and damage while the work is scheduled.

Why rodents are a health hazard in Logan Square

The health stakes are real: rats spread hantavirus, salmonella, and leptospirosis through droppings and urine, their waste triggers asthma and allergies, and they carry fleas and ticks indoors. Cleanup of heavily soiled areas should be done with proper protection, not a household vacuum that can aerosolize contaminants.

Is exclusion worth it in Logan Square?

Yes — trapping alone only removes the rodents present now. Permanent exclusion (sealing every gap around pipes, vents, and the foundation) is what stops new rats from re-entering, which is why it is the core of lasting control in the Logan Square area.

Is my Logan Square landlord responsible for rodents?

Structural gaps — foundation cracks, unscreened vents, worn door sweeps — are building-maintenance issues, so Illinois habitability law almost always makes the landlord responsible for sealing entry points and arranging removal when the tenant did not cause the problem. Put every notice in writing.
